TYLER BAILLIE v R [2021] NZCA 458
- Citation
- [2021] NZCA 458
- Court
- Court of Appeal
The Court held the trial judge's s 122 directions, considered as a whole and tailored to the evidence, were adequate for the incentivised witnesses (including the two cellmates and Harmon); the admissions together with circumstantial evidence were sufficient to support the convictions; s 104(1)(b) applied because the murder was for reward (murder for hire) though personal circumstances (notably addiction and background) warranted mitigation of the MPI; by majority the 17‑year minimum periods were substituted with 14 years for each appellant (convictions upheld).
